Got a couple jars at a Sale today.....50 cents each....both have ground lips....
- the Lightning says Putnam 493 on the bottom, and the lid says patd jan 5 75 / patd apr 25 82 / and reisd june  5 77? the inside of the lid has a small star.
-the Cohansey has a faint 2 ? on the bottom and the lid says patented  January 18 1876, and Cohansey Glass Manuf Co. Philadelphia PA Patented July 16 1872.

Are either a "good" find?   Thanks!

Hi Julie - When I read your description, I thought you did fine for your 50 cents apiece. The Trademark Lightning worth 3 bucks or so, and the Cohansey at $30 - $40.  Well - that was before I saw your photo, and that sure does look like a half pint!  The good news on that is that it's worth $300 - $350.  A few more days like that and you can quit the day job!  Great find!!  -Tammy
